  3. android/guava/src/com/google/common/collect/ExplicitOrdering.java

      }
    
      ExplicitOrdering(ImmutableMap<T, Integer> rankMap) {
        this.rankMap = rankMap;
      }
    
      @Override
      public int compare(T left, T right) {
        return rank(left) - rank(right); // safe because both are nonnegative
      }
    
      private int rank(T value) {
        Integer rank = rankMap.get(value);
        if (rank == null) {
          throw new IncomparableValueException(value);
        }
        return rank;
      }
